The ECC35 is a medium impedance double triode with a high gain of 68. It was designed for use as a phase splitter and voltage amplifier in AF amplifiers..
The anode structure of the twin triodes is seen in the picture above. The anodes are very thin in relation to their area.
The wide glass tube envelope is 28 mm in diameter, and excluding the IO base pins, is 66 mm tall.
References: Datasheet, 1043, 3002 & 1040. Type ECC35 was first introduced in 1942.
